The Mexico security market has shown significant growth, reaching an estimated value of USD 2.43 billion in 2024. This market is anticipated to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.6% from 2025 to 2034, reaching nearly USD 3.66 billion by 2034. This growth is driven by the increasing need for safety and security solutions across various sectors, including government, defense, transportation, and commercial industries. With the rising concern over crime rates, the adoption of advanced security systems and services is gaining momentum.

Market Trends
The Mexico security market is witnessing several key trends that are influencing the market's development. One major trend is the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) into security systems. These technologies enable smarter surveillance, more accurate threat detection, and faster response times. Additionally, there is a growing preference for cloud-based security solutions that offer scalability, flexibility, and cost-effectiveness.
The adoption of video surveillance and access control systems is also on the rise. As businesses and governments seek to protect sensitive infrastructure, the demand for comprehensive, integrated security solutions is increasing. The trend of automation and remote monitoring in security systems is enhancing the efficiency of security operations, particularly in commercial and industrial sectors.

Competitor Analysis
Several prominent companies dominate the Mexico security market, offering a wide range of security solutions and services. Key players include:
- Teledyne Technologies Inc. (Teledyne FLIR LLC): Known for its advanced thermal imaging and surveillance technologies, Teledyne is a leading provider of security systems for both commercial and military applications.
- Canon Inc. (Axis Communications AB): Canon, through its Axis Communications division, offers high-quality video surveillance and access control systems, widely used in government and commercial sectors.
- Honeywell International Inc.: Honeywell is a major player in providing integrated security solutions, including video surveillance, intrusion detection, and access control systems.
- Johnson Controls International Plc: Johnson Controls offers a wide range of security systems, focusing on smart buildings and connected devices.
- WESCO International, Inc. (Anixter Inc.): WESCO is a key player in the distribution of security products, including video surveillance and access control systems.
- ASSA ABLOY AB: Known for its access control and locking solutions, ASSA ABLOY is a leader in physical security.
- Global Guardian, LLC and Black Mountain Solutions Ltd.: These companies offer managed security services, risk assessments, and security system integration.
- Eagle Eye International Protective Services: A key player in providing protective services, surveillance, and security consulting.
